Remodeling costs vary based on your specific goals. Choosing high-end materials like natural stone, custom cabinetry, or designer hardware will increase the total. Labor costs fluctuate depending on whether you are simply updating fixtures or doing a full layout overhaul that requires moving plumbing and electrical lines. Keeping your existing footprint is the most effective way to save, while expanding the space or adding luxury features like steam showers pushes the budget higher. A dedicated contractor acts as the lead for your renovation project. You need one when you want to ensure that every aspect of the job, from removing old features to installing new plumbing and wall surrounds, is done to a high standard. A good contractor coordinates the different parts of the job to prevent delays and ensures the materials are installed correctly, which helps prevent future issues like water leaks or mold growth.

In Topeka bathrooms, licensed pros typically recommend satin or semi-gloss paint finishes for walls. These paints are more resistant to moisture and easier to clean, which is important in humid environments. They can guide you on specific product recommendations.
